The court held that the prosecution proved a prima facie case, s.20 of the 2017 Act is a statutory rebuttable presumption which, once engaged, placed the burden on the appellant to show on the balance of probabilities that he took all reasonable steps to ascertain the victim's age; the appellant failed to rebut the presumption because the photos, videos and communications demonstrated the victim was a child and his explanations were implausible, therefore conviction and the reduced sentences (10 years imprisonment per count, concurrent, and whipping plus ancillary orders) were affirmed.
